In Drew Yancey's absense, Albion has had 3 players step up with career highs in the last two games.

Dave Stasiak had 22 against Alma, and Saturday Andre Bridges and Robbie Clark each had 17.

Its always interesting to see how teams react to injuries to important players, some teams go in the tank, others rally around the injury and have players who fill the void.  When and if the injured players returns, they're often better teams. 

Albion and Calvin both seem to have taken path #2. 

I'm not sure Albion will get Yancey back this season.  But I'm certain KVS has to be happy with Matt Veltema's play in Veldhouse's absense.
